The legal framework for UTM (Unmanned aircraft system Traffic Management) will need to develop as regulators grapple with issues that relate to legal responsibility and accountability as the proliferation of drones increases.

Unmanned Aircraft System (UAS) Traffic Management (UTM) Enabling Civilian Low-altitude Airspace and Unmanned Aircraft System Operations.

What is the problem?

Many beneficial civilian applications of the UAS have been proposed, that include goods delivery, medical deliveries, infrastructure surveillance, search and rescue and agricultural monitoring. Currently, there is no established UTM infrastructure to enable and safely manage the widespread use of BVLOS low-altitude airspace and UAS operations, regardless of the type of UAS.
